Over time serpentine belts stretch, crack, and the ribs that ride on the accessory pulleys being to wear smooth. A squealing noise that increases with engine speed or as engine driven accessories are turned on may be noted. The noise is caused by the belt slipping on the pulleys, insufficiently driving them. Ineffective air conditioning, a battery warning light, or intermittent power steering assist can result from this.
The bad thermostat can cause two different sets of problems, depending on whether it's stuck open or stuck closed.
A thermostat that is stuck open can cause the engine to run colder than normal and turn on the check engine light. It may also cause poor fuel mileage and the heater to blow cool air.
A thermostat that is stuck closed will cause the vehicle to overheat. If a new thermostat doesn't resolve engine temperature problems, the cooling system needs to be checked for other issues.

When the engine coolant temperature sensor fails, it will send inaccurate information to the vehicle’s computer, causing the computer to react to false operating conditions. This will cause the engine to consume more fuel than normal, depleting fuel mileage, and causing black, sooty smoke from the engine under moderate to heavy acceleration. The check engine light will illuminate, and on-board diagnostic trouble codes may be stored for exhaust and emission system failure, fuel delivery system failure, and engine cooling system failure. Overheating may also occur, as the coolant sensor may be leaking fluid out of the engine, creating a an air pocket in the system.
To effectively diagnose a non-functioning radiator fan in a 1999 Suzuki Swift, it's essential to adopt a systematic approach that prioritizes simpler checks before delving into more complex diagnostics. Start by inspecting the fuse linked to the radiator fan; a blown fuse is a common and easily rectifiable issue that could restore functionality. If the fuse is intact, the next step is to test the fan motor directly by disconnecting it from the vehicle and connecting it to a battery. This will help you ascertain whether the motor is operational or needs replacement. Following this, check the fan relay, as a faulty relay can disrupt the power supply to the fan. If the relay is functioning properly, turn your attention to the fan control module and the temperature sensor, both of which are critical for the fan's operation. Finally, ensure that the radiator fan switch is in good working order and examine the overall electrical system for any underlying issues that might be affecting the fan's performance. By following this methodical process, you can effectively pinpoint and resolve the cause of the radiator fan malfunction.
When dealing with a non-working radiator fan in a 1999 Suzuki Swift, it's crucial to understand the common problems that could be causing the malfunction. One of the primary culprits is the fan assembly itself, which may be damaged or worn out over time. Additionally, the fan clutch can fail, preventing the fan from engaging when needed. Another frequent issue is the coolant temperature sensor, which may not accurately signal the fan to turn on, leading to overheating. Electrical problems are also common; a blown fuse or a faulty relay can interrupt the power supply to the fan, while damaged wiring can prevent proper operation. Furthermore, low coolant levels can affect the cooling system's efficiency, and a malfunctioning fan control module may fail to activate the fan at the right times. Addressing these issues promptly is essential, as driving without a functioning radiator fan can lead to severe engine overheating and potential damage.
